Colocación de las pilas

Las pilas suministradas con este equipo le permitirán
comprobar las operaciones iniciales, pero no durarán mucho
tiempo. Se recomienda utilizar pilas alcalinas de larga
duración.
PRECAUCIÓN
El uso incorrecto de las pilas puede provocar situaciones
peligrosas tales como fugas y explosiones. Tenga en
cuenta las siguientes precauciones:
-
Nunca utilice pilas nuevas y usadas al mismo tiempo.
-
Instale las pilas correctamente, haciendo coincidir los
polos positivo y negativo de las mismas con las marcas
de polaridad impresas en el compartimiento de las
pilas.
-
Aunque distintas pilas tengan la misma forma, pueden
tener tensiones diferentes. No mezcle pilas de distinto
tipo.
-
Cuando se deshaga de las pilas usadas, asegúrese de
respetar las disposiciones gubernamentales o las
normas de las instituciones medioambientales públicas
que rigen en su país o región.
-
No use ni guarde pilas en lugares expuestos a la luz
solar directa o en lugares con un calor excesivo, como
el interior de un coche o cerca de un calefactor. Esto
puede provocar fugas en las pilas, sobrecalentamiento,
explosiones o incendios. También puede reducir la vida
o el rendimiento de las mismas.

The Pioneer VSX-921-K is a receiver that offers various features for audio enthusiasts. With a signal-to-noise ratio of 98 dB, it ensures a clean and distortion-free audio output. The impedance of 16 Ω allows for compatibility with a wide range of speakers. Featuring 7.1 channels, the VSX-921-K provides immersive surround sound capabilities. It also offers multiple multichannel audio input and output terminals, allowing for seamless connectivity with other compatible devices. With two digital audio optical inputs and one digital audio coaxial input, users can connect their audio sources with ease. The receiver includes two component video inputs and four HDMI inputs, providing flexibility and versatility when connecting video devices such as game consoles, Blu-ray players, or set-top boxes. It also features one USB port, allowing users to connect external devices for media playback. In terms of connectivity options, the VSX-921-K offers one composite video input and one HDMI output. This allows users to connect their display devices, such as televisions or projectors, easily. Additionally, it provides one composite video output for added convenience. With its specifications and multiple input and output options, the Pioneer VSX-921-K is a versatile receiver that aims to provide high-quality audio and video performance. Its diverse range of connectivity options and multi-channel audio capabilities make it suitable for various home entertainment setups.

When is my volume too loud?

A volume above 80 decibels can be harmful to hearing. When the volume exceeds 120 decibels, direct damage can even occur. The chance of hearing damage depends on the listening frequency and duration.

Can bluetooth devices of different brands be connected to each other?

Yes, bluetooth is a universal method that allows different devices equipped with bluetooth to connect to each other.

What is bluetooth?

Bluetooth is a way of exchanging data wirelessly between electronic devices via radio waves. The distance between the two devices that exchange data can in most cases be no more than ten metres.

What is HDMI?

HDMI stands for High-Definition Multimedia Interface. An HDMI cable is used to transport audio and video signals between devices.

How can I best clean my receiver?

A slightly damp cleaning cloth or soft, dust-free cloth works best to remove fingerprints. Dust in hard-to-reach places is best removed with compressed air.
